General Description
This dual driver-receiver is designed for high speed interconnects utilizing
Low Voltage Differential Signaling (LVDS) technology. The driver accepts LVTTL
inputs and translates them to LVDS outputs. The receiver accepts LVDS inputs and
translates them to LVTTL outputs. The LVDS levels have a typical differential
output swing of 350mV which provides for low EMI at ultra-low power dissipation
even at high frequencies. The FIN1049 can accept LVPECL inputs for translating
from LVPECL to LVDS. The En and Enb inputs are ANDed together to enable/disable
the outputs. The enables are common to all four outputs. A single-line driver
and single-line receiver function is also available in the FIN1019.

Features
- Greater than 400Mbps Data Rate
- 3.3V Power Supply Operation
- Low Power Dissipation
- Fail-Safe Protection for Open-Circuit Conditions
- Meets or Exceeds the TIA/EIA-644-A LVDS standard
- 16-pin TSSOP Package Saves Space
- Flow-Through Pinout Simplifies PCB Layout
- Enable/Disable for All Outputs
- Industrial Operating Temperature Range: -40°C to +85°C
